Who Did God Foreknow? Romans 8:28–30 Explained
What does “foreknew” mean in Romans 8:29? Does this passage teach unconditional election, or is Paul describing something else? In this episode, we examine Romans 8:28–30 in context and argue that Paul is not explaining how individuals are chosen for salvation, but what God has planned for those who love Him. Instead of a deterministic reading, we explore how “foreknew” connects to the faithful remnant and God’s covenant people in Romans 8–11. You’ll see why: “Foreknew” does not mean “predetermined” The focus is on the destiny of believers, not their selection God’s purpose is to conform His people to Christ Blog Article: https://grafted-theology.blogspot.com...
